> I experience the problem described in previous
> mailings as "focus dies". It happens after a while
> of working with multiple windows. I do not know
> if many xterms would make such an effect - never
> happened so far. Typically I would have a few xterms
> and Netscape open. Sometimes Framemaker, tkman etc.
> Suddenly the focus stays in one of the windows and
> nothing makes it move to another window. If I close
> the window that has the focus, I am left with
> no focused object on the desktop at all.
> 
> I read posts on this problem from the mailing list
> archives. The problem was described but no solution
> was proposed as far as I can tell.
> 
> The problem is persistent on two platforms. One is 
> Sun Solaris running AfterStep 1.0 and another is
> Linux running AfterStep 1.4.0.

	This would be the infamous "NumLock" bug, which dates as far back
as Dec. '96 - you'd think it would be solved by now. :) I bet you have
been using your NumLock key, right?  I myself had this happen to me just a
few seconds ago.  While looking through the archives, noone had a way to
fix it after it has happened, just simply don't keep the NumLock on - ya
know, hindsight stuff - duh!  I don't think that is a good solution -
don't use 16 keys on your keyboard...just crazy. :)
	I have reinit'd both my look and feel; this has no affect.
Restarting is like I'm back in winblows (and who wants this!).  Some (in
the archives) suggested that using the WinList will allow you to gain
focus - I don't use this thing, so I couldn't tell you if it works.  I
have been successful with using the Pager to give a window focus - what a
pain! - clicking on those tiny windows in the pager is a bitch at
1600x1200!!
	So I am now stuck with having to use the Pager to gain focus -
this really sucks folks!  Surely someone has a fix for this.  I sure would
hate to have to restart AfterStep after everytime I wanted to use a
certain 16 keys on my keyboard. This sounds like a high priority bug
(since it has existed since '96).
